2024年1月16日发(作者:)

curl linux编译

Curl是一个非常流行的开源命令行工具和库,用于在Linux系统上通过HTTP、FTP、SMTP等协议进行数据传输和通信。本篇文章将介绍如何在Linux上编译和安装Curl。

1. 安装编译工具

在Linux系统上编译Curl需要安装一些编译工具和库文件。可以使用以下命令在Ubuntu和Debian系统上安装:

sudo apt-get update

sudo apt-get install build-essential

如果您使用的是其他发行版,可以根据具体情况选择合适的安装包。

2. 下载Curl源代码

在编译Curl之前,我们需要先下载Curl的源代码。可以从Curl官网下载最新的稳定版源代码:

/

可以使用如下命令将源代码保存到本地:

wget /download/

3. 解压源代码

下载完成后,我们需要解压Curl源代码。可以使用如下命令将源代码解压到当前目录:

tar -xzvf

4. 进入源码目录并编译

- 1 -

解压完成后,我们需要进入到Curl源码目录,并进行编译。可以使用如下命令完成:

cd curl-7.79.0

./configure

make

上述命令将会执行3个步骤:

- 进入Curl源码目录

- 执行configure命令,该命令将检查系统环境并生成Makefile文件

- 执行make命令,该命令将编译源代码并生成可执行文件

编译完成后,可以使用如下命令进行安装:

sudo make install

5. 验证安装

安装完成后,我们需要验证Curl是否已经安装成功。可以使用如下命令进行验证:

curl --version

该命令将输出Curl的版本信息,如果输出信息中包含Curl的版本号,则表示安装成功。

至此,我们已经成功在Linux系统上编译和安装了Curl。Curl是一个非常强大的工具,它可以帮助我们快速便捷地进行HTTP、FTP、SMTP等协议的数据传输和通信。希望这篇文章对您有所帮助。

- 2 -